The Drake Hotel is having “50 & BEAUTIFUL” Catwalk Friday Specials. The upcoming event will be on October 23 from 1:00 to 5:00. And the official hatter will be Joy Scott.

50 & Beautiful is a special afternoon event that celebrates influential women, ages 50 and above, from all walks of life. During Afternoon Tea on Fridays in October, guests will be treated to fashion shows, showcasing collections from five of Chicago designers.

For this specific event all models are 50 and above. Some of our featured models and contributors include: Former model/actress, fashion editor, and blogger Candace Jordan Former model/dancer/actress turned activist, Cookie Cohen, Owner & Executive VP of Rogers and Holland’s Jewelers, Juell Kadet

This very special catwalk is a fundraiser dedicated to the courageous spirit of Lynn Sage. The Lynn Sage Cancer Research Foundation supports innovative contributions to the understanding, research and treatment of breast cancer, in partnership with Northwestern Memorial Hospital and the Robert H. Lurie Comprehensive Cancer Center of Northwestern University. All of our designers, and some models, will be donating their favorite piece to be displayed for silent auction. All proceeds will benefit this foundation.

Reservations required for an afternoon of High Fashion. Guests will be served tea, scones, finger sandwiches and pastries, while watching the fashion show.

Joy Scott Milliner
Joy Scott is a British hat designer with a passion for the unique. After studying fashion design at the Academy of Merchandising and Design and the London College of Fashion, Joy studied for a C&G and HNC in Millinery Design, at the Kensington and Chelsea College in London. To add to the uniqueness of her designs, Joy also studied special millinery techniques with Marie O'Regan, Royal Milliner to the Queen. Joy finds inspiration everywhere and sees hats in nearly everything- from the architectural shapes of buildings to modern furniture designs and sculptural shapes.
